Overall Review of Hampton Ridge

common 2 reviews mention this

Staff attention is a mixed picture

Residents describe both very attentive caregivers and times when help was slow or missing.

Many reviews praise the staff for being kind, professional, and responsive to daily needs. Several families also say they found communication and follow-through reassuring. At the same time, other reviews report missed basic care items and delayed responses to call bells, including examples of residents waiting for assistance with toileting, pain needs, or meals.

differentiator 2 reviews mention this

Therapy progress is a frequent bright spot

Physical and occupational therapy is a standout for many residents recovering after illness or surgery.

Multiple reviews highlight therapy as a key reason they felt they were improving, including getting back to walking, regaining strength, and making progress day by day. Families also mention thorough PT/OT support and staff who worked directly with patients during therapy. Even among critical reviews, some still distinguish the therapy team as more accommodating than other parts of the stay, which suggests rehab sessions were the most consistent part of the experience.

common 2 reviews mention this

Food quality gets both praise and complaints

Dining is described as acceptable by some families and poorly by others.

Several residents and families say meals were enjoyable, with comments about good food quality and satisfaction with the meals they received. Others add that dietary support mattered for comfort and routine. Other reviews criticize food quality and consistency, including complaints that meals were missed or not aligned with a resident’s needs.

caveat 2 reviews mention this

Care response issues raise safety concerns

Some reviewers raise serious concerns about supervision, call-bell response, and basic care.

A recurring negative theme is inadequate supervision and delayed help, with reviews describing long waits for assistance and residents left without needed support. Several comments also describe hygiene and toileting care problems, including reports of residents left in soiled diapers or without showers. There are also reviews that mention residents being placed at medical risk due to delayed or inconsistent monitoring, reinforcing the importance families place on reliable day-to-day nursing support.

common 2 reviews mention this

Facility cleanliness is commonly mentioned

Residents and families frequently comment on cleanliness, with most calling the building clean.

Many reviews explicitly describe the facility as clean and well-kept, sometimes noting cleanliness in rooms, floors, and common areas. A few families also mention odor-free or spotless conditions. At the same time, some critical reviews contradict this by describing dirt, poor cleaning, and lingering odors, indicating cleanliness may not be consistently experienced across stays.

Nearby Places of Interest

This section of Toms River, New Jersey, offers convenient access to a variety of healthcare facilities such as Childrens Specialized Hospital and Ocean Medical Center. Additionally, there are several reputable physicians and pharmacies in close proximity. Residents can also enjoy a range of dining options including Wendy's, McDonald's, and TGI Friday's, as well as cafes like Starbucks. The area is home to the Presbyterian Church of Toms River for those seeking spiritual fulfillment. Transportation is easily accessible with the Toms River Bus Terminal nearby. For entertainment, residents can visit AMC Brick Plaza 1 theater or explore nature at Jakes Branch County Park or Angela Hibbard Dog Park. Overall, this part of Toms River provides a well-rounded community with various amenities for senior living.
